Explosion proof variable frequency motors (VFDs) are an essential component in various industrial applications, particularly in environments prone to hazardous conditions. These motors are designed to operate safely in areas where flammable gases or vapors may be present, making them particularly valuable in the automotive and electronics sectors.
One of the primary benefits of an explosion proof variable frequency motor is its ability to regulate the speed and torque of the motor based on the operational requirements. This is achieved through the use of a variable frequency drive, which adjusts the frequency and voltage supplied to the motor. In automotive applications, this can lead to enhanced performance, improved energy efficiency, and reduced wear and tear on components. By fine-tuning motor operations, businesses can optimize energy consumption and improve overall system reliability.
Safety is a paramount concern when dealing with automotive electronic components, especially when considering environments that may expose equipment to flammable materials. Explosion proof motors are constructed with robust enclosures that prevent any internal sparks or heat from igniting potentially hazardous atmospheres. This makes them ideal for use in manufacturing setups, repair shops, or even during automotive assembly processes where volatile substances may be present.
Moreover, the integration of variable frequency drives allows for smoother motor operation, which can significantly reduce mechanical stress and extend the lifespan of both the motor and related components. The ability to adjust performance dynamically based on load requirements leads to not only improved efficiency but also less downtime for maintenance and repairs.
When selecting explosion proof variable frequency motors, it is essential to consider factors such as the motor's explosion protection rating, the environment it will operate in, and its compliance with relevant industry standards. A thorough understanding of these specifications ensures that the selected motor will perform reliably and safely in the intended application.
In conclusion, explosion proof variable frequency motors play a critical role in the automotive industry, particularly within the realm of electrical components. Their ability to enhance safety while providing efficient and reliable performance makes them a valuable investment for any business operating in potentially hazardous environments. As technology continues to advance, the integration of such motors will likely become increasingly prevalent, driving innovation and safety in automotive applications.
